Output 153aa07f9c683d62f672c5ec4648435ccb39758d6b84183b3096fdfbc17e0903:1

value
8092107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7961abc9cc7a84e2c7952c3e1f1d785856cc523 OP_EQUAL
address
3MLw2E6jmXA1KWgZra11A3556pi94Hjtnr
transaction
153aa07f9c683d62f672c5ec4648435ccb39758d6b84183b3096fdfbc17e0903
spent
true